According to the Department of Tourism , the decision to postpone the event was made after the Standing Committee of the Ho Chi Minh City Party Committee reviewed and evaluated the actual conditions related to the scale, preparation progress as well as the coordination requirements between departments, branches and participating units. On that basis, the City agreed not to organize the festival according to the previously announced plan.
The Department of Tourism said it will continue to research and advise on a new organization time and provide official information immediately after approval by the Ho Chi Minh City People's Committee, creating conditions for units, localities and businesses to proactively arrange and coordinate implementation in the coming time.

Previously, the 3rd Ho Chi Minh City River Festival was scheduled to take place from November 29 to December 31, lasting more than a month with a series of rich cultural and tourism activities along the Saigon River, the canal system and ports in the city. The highlight is the live show Signature Show - The Bridge Through Space, combining music, dance, circus and modern performance technology. In addition, the festival also has many outstanding activities such as "on the wharf, under the boat" space, street carnival, light art, boat racing, food festival and a series of events to stimulate waterway tourism. These activities aim to promote the image of the river city, while strengthening tourism connections between Ho Chi Minh City and neighboring localities.
Held for the first time in 2023, the Ho Chi Minh City River Festival is considered a new festival model that opens up a creative approach in developing community tourism, connecting people with the city's unique cultural and economic flow.
According to the latest statistics, in the past 11 months, Ho Chi Minh City's tourism industry has achieved revenue of about VND233,566 billion, completing 80.5% of the 2025 plan. The city is vigorously implementing product groups with high added value such as medical tourism, MICE tourism, night tourism and culinary tourism. In particular, products of panoramic city views by helicopter and waterway tourism are attracting the attention of the high-end customer segment.
